.elementor-57 .elementor-element.elementor-element-8130bfa{--display:flex;--min-height:380px;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--overflow:hidden;--overlay-opacity:.65}.elementor-57 .elementor-element.elementor-element-8130bfa:not(.elementor-motion-effects-element-type-background),.elementor-57 .elementor-element.elementor-element-8130bfa>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#2094A07A}.elementor-57 .elementor-element.elementor-element-8130bfa:before,.elementor-57 .elementor-element.elementor-element-8130bfa>.elementor-background-video-container:before,.elementor-57 .elementor-element.elementor-element-8130bfa>.e-con-inner>.elementor-background-video-container:before,.elementor-57 .elementor-element.elementor-element-8130bfa>.elementor-background-slideshow:before,.elementor-57 .elementor-element.elementor-element-8130bfa>.e-con-inner>.elementor-background-slideshow:before,.elementor-57 .elementor-element.elementor-element-8130bfa>.elementor-motion-effects-container>.elementor-motion-effects-layer:before{background-color:#2094A0FC;--background-overlay:''}.elementor-57 .elementor-element.elementor-element-8130bfa>.elementor-shape-bottom svg,.elementor-57 .elementor-element.elementor-element-8130bfa>.e-con-inner>.elementor-shape-bottom svg{width:calc(100% + 1.3px);height:118px}.elementor-57 .elementor-element.elementor-element-96f7504{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:flex-start;border-style:none;--border-style:none}.elementor-57 .elementor-element.elementor-element-96f7504>.elementor-shape-bottom svg,.elementor-57 .elementor-element.elementor-element-96f7504>.e-con-inner>.elementor-shape-bottom svg{width:calc(182% + 1.3px);height:0}.elementor-57 .elementor-element.elementor-element-cc55d58>.elementor-widget-container{margin:0;border-style:none}.elementor-57 .elementor-element.elementor-element-cc55d58{text-align:center}.elementor-57 .elementor-element.elementor-element-cc55d58 img{width:100%;max-width:100%;height:240px;object-fit:cover;object-position:center left;opacity:1;border-style:solid;border-width:9px;border-color:var(--e-global-color-accent);border-radius:100px}.elementor-57 .elementor-element.elementor-element-cb5df47{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center}.elementor-57 .elementor-element.elementor-element-4144233>.elementor-widget-container{margin:0;padding:40px 0 0}.elementor-57 .elementor-element.elementor-element-4144233{text-align:center}.elementor-57 .elementor-element.elementor-element-4144233 img{width:100%}.elementor-57 .elementor-element.elementor-element-b4bb56e>.elementor-widget-container{margin:-20px 0 25px;padding:0}.elementor-57 .elementor-element.elementor-element-b4bb56e{text-align:center}.elementor-57 .elementor-element.elementor-element-b4bb56e .elementor-heading-title{font-family:"Open Sans",Sans-serif;font-size:22px;font-weight:400;font-style:normal;color:var(--e-global-color-text)}.elementor-57 .elementor-element.elementor-element-90a6d5e{--iteration-count:infinite;--animation-duration:1.2s;--dynamic-text-color:var(--e-global-color-text)}.elementor-57 .elementor-element.elementor-element-90a6d5e>.elementor-widget-container{padding:0 50px 30px}.elementor-57 .elementor-element.elementor-element-90a6d5e .elementor-headline{text-align:center;font-family:"Open Sans",Sans-serif;font-size:28px;font-weight:400}.elementor-57 .elementor-element.elementor-element-90a6d5e .elementor-headline-dynamic-wrapper path{stroke:#ffd869;stroke-width:4px}.elementor-57 .elementor-element.elementor-element-90a6d5e .elementor-headline-plain-text{color:var(--e-global-color-text)}.elementor-57 .elementor-element.elementor-element-90a6d5e .elementor-headline-dynamic-text{font-family:"Open Sans",Sans-serif;font-weight:400}.elementor-57 .elementor-element.elementor-element-2ea6449{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--overflow:hidden;--margin-top:30px;--margin-bottom:100px;--margin-left:0px;--margin-right:0px}.elementor-57 .elementor-element.elementor-element-216164c .elementor-heading-title{font-family:"Open Sans",Sans-serif;font-size:40px;font-weight:600;color:var(--e-global-color-primary)}.elementor-57 .elementor-element.elementor-element-d14ce99{text-align:left;font-family:"Open Sans",Sans-serif;font-size:19px;font-weight:400;color:var(--e-global-color-text)}@media(max-width:1024px){.elementor-57 .elementor-element.elementor-element-8130bfa{--min-height:262px;--padding-top:0px;--padding-bottom:0px;--padding-left:30px;--padding-right:30px}.elementor-57 .elementor-element.elementor-element-8130bfa>.elementor-shape-bottom svg,.elementor-57 .elementor-element.elementor-element-8130bfa>.e-con-inner>.elementor-shape-bottom svg{width:calc(110% + 1.3px);height:90px}.elementor-57 .elementor-element.elementor-element-cc55d58>.elementor-widget-container{margin:0}.elementor-57 .elementor-element.elementor-element-cc55d58{text-align:center}.elementor-57 .elementor-element.elementor-element-cc55d58 img{width:100%;height:136px;border-width:6px;border-radius:200px}.elementor-57 .elementor-element.elementor-element-4144233>.elementor-widget-container{padding:0}.elementor-57 .elementor-element.elementor-element-4144233 img{width:100%}.elementor-57 .elementor-element.elementor-element-b4bb56e>.elementor-widget-container{margin:-15px 0 10px}.elementor-57 .elementor-element.elementor-element-b4bb56e .elementor-heading-title{font-size:17px}.elementor-57 .elementor-element.elementor-element-90a6d5e .elementor-headline{font-size:18px}.elementor-57 .elementor-element.elementor-element-2ea6449{--padding-top:0px;--padding-bottom:0px;--padding-left:30px;--padding-right:30px}.elementor-57 .elementor-element.elementor-element-216164c .elementor-heading-title{font-size:33px}.elementor-57 .elementor-element.elementor-element-d14ce99{font-size:17px}}@media(min-width:768px){.elementor-57 .elementor-element.elementor-element-8130bfa{--content-width:1100px}.elementor-57 .elementor-element.elementor-element-96f7504{--width:40%}.elementor-57 .elementor-element.elementor-element-cb5df47{--width:60%}.elementor-57 .elementor-element.elementor-element-2ea6449{--content-width:900px}}@media(max-width:1024px) and (min-width:768px){.elementor-57 .elementor-element.elementor-element-8130bfa{--content-width:750px}.elementor-57 .elementor-element.elementor-element-2ea6449{--content-width:750px}}@media(max-width:767px){.elementor-57 .elementor-element.elementor-element-8130bfa{--content-width:350px;--min-height:49px;--justify-content:center;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px}.elementor-57 .elementor-element.elementor-element-8130bfa>.elementor-shape-bottom svg,.elementor-57 .elementor-element.elementor-element-8130bfa>.e-con-inner>.elementor-shape-bottom svg{width:calc(149% + 1.3px);height:28px}.elementor-57 .elementor-element.elementor-element-96f7504{--width:115px;--min-height:0px;--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px}.elementor-57 .elementor-element.elementor-element-cc55d58>.elementor-widget-container{margin:0}.elementor-57 .elementor-element.elementor-element-cc55d58 img{width:100%;max-width:100%;height:113px;object-fit:cover;object-position:center center}.elementor-57 .elementor-element.elementor-element-cb5df47{--width:228px;--margin-top:4px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px}.elementor-57 .elementor-element.elementor-element-4144233 img{width:100%}.elementor-57 .elementor-element.elementor-element-b4bb56e .elementor-heading-title{font-size:11px}.elementor-57 .elementor-element.elementor-element-90a6d5e>.elementor-widget-container{margin:-18px 0 0;padding:0 0 4px}.elementor-57 .elementor-element.elementor-element-90a6d5e .elementor-headline{text-align:center;font-size:14px}.elementor-57 .elementor-element.elementor-element-2ea6449{--margin-top:20px;--margin-bottom:50px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px}.elementor-57 .elementor-element.elementor-element-216164c .elementor-heading-title{font-size:27px}.elementor-57 .elementor-element.elementor-element-d14ce99{font-size:16px}}@font-face{font-family:'Open Sans';font-style:normal;font-weight:400;font-display:auto;src:url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-VariableFont_wdth_wght.woff') format('woff'),url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-VariableFont_wdthwght.ttf') format('truetype')}@font-face{font-family:'Open Sans';font-style:italic;font-weight:400;font-display:auto;src:url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-Italic-VariableFont_wdth_wght.woff') format('woff'),url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-Italic-VariableFont_wdthwght-1.ttf') format('truetype')}@font-face{font-family:'Open Sans';font-style:normal;font-weight:600;font-display:auto;src:url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-VariableFont_wdth_wght.woff') format('woff'),url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-VariableFont_wdthwght.ttf') format('truetype')}@font-face{font-family:'Open Sans';font-style:normal;font-weight:400;font-display:auto;src:url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-VariableFont_wdth_wght.woff') format('woff'),url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-VariableFont_wdthwght.ttf') format('truetype')}@font-face{font-family:'Open Sans';font-style:normal;font-weight:300;font-display:auto;src:url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-VariableFont_wdth_wght.woff') format('woff'),url('http://neuwp.schwimminklusiv.de/wp-content/uploads/2025/03/OpenSans-VariableFont_wdthwght.ttf') format('truetype')}